The New Orleans Office of Inspector General says a tow truck driver for the city faces criminal charges after a joint investigation with Louisiana State Police Troop NOLA.
Troopers booked the driver last week on charges of malfeasance in office, obstruction of justice, and injuring public records.
"The investigation revealed that [the] tow truck driver was bypassing the official tow process by accepting cash payments in exchange for not towing vehicles," according to a statement from the OIG.
The inspector general's investigation remains active and is seeking information from anyone who may have been asked to pay cash in exchange for the release of their vehicle.
